In article <jramos-2411951447560001@jramos.port.net> jramos@interport.net ( ) writes:
Has anyone been able to get macBSD up and running? If anyone has could you
give me some basic info.
Well, you're posting on the wrong newsgroup, because "MacBSD" is
another name for the NetBSD/Mac68k port (i. e. not FreeBSD).
Consult www.NetBSD.org, or send mail to port-mac68k@NetBSD.org.
